A simple one phase preparation of organically capped gold nanocrystals

Abstract

A simple reproducible one-phase preparation of highly monodispersed organically passivated gold nanoparticles is described. The effect of the capping ligand on the particle size is discussed along with the manipulation of the nanoparticles into colloidal crystals and 2D arrays.
